Slot machines themselves are a type of electronic gambling game that uses reels (virtual or physical) spinning randomly upon activation. The objective is simple: match winning combinations by landing specific symbols in predefined patterns on the paylines. Traditional slots rely heavily on luck, while modern games incorporate features like bonus rounds, free spins, and wilds to enhance gameplay experience.

How the Concept Works

Online slot platforms like Slot Boss offer an assortment of games that cater to different tastes. When users select a game or launch it, they are presented with virtual reels displaying various symbols (often themed around specific genres). The user inputs bets before spinning, which can be done manually or using automated features.

Games in the platform typically follow standard slot mechanisms:

  1. Spinning : A random spin results in winning or losing combinations.
  2. Payouts : Winnings are awarded according to predefined tables and rules, with payouts usually occurring on paylines across the reels.
  3. Bonuses : Specific games feature bonus rounds triggered by certain wins, offering additional free spins or enhanced rewards.
